
Prestige Consumer Healthcare Subsidiary Issues $400M Senior Notes
Prestige Brands,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c., has issued $400.0 million in 6.250% senior notes due 2034. The notes are senior unsecured obligations, guaranteed by the parent company and certain subsidiaries, with interest payable semi-annually. The Indenture includes standard covenants restricting certain corporate actions and outlines redemption options for Prestige Brands, including a make-whole premium for early redemption and a 101% repurchase offer in case of a Change of Control.
Key Highlights
- Prestige Brands, Inc. issued $400.0 million aggregate principal amount of senior notes.
- The notes carry an interest rate of 6.250% and are due on July 15, 2034.
- Interest will be paid semi-annually on January 15 and July 15, starting January 15, 2027.
- Prestige Brands can redeem notes on or after July 15, 2029, at specified redemption prices.
- Prior to July 15, 2029, notes can be redeemed with a make-whole premium.
- Up to 40% of notes can be redeemed before July 15, 2029, using net proceeds from certain equity offerings.
- A Change of Control event requires an offer to purchase notes at 101% of principal amount.
